The reason why Acura used the slide out moonroof is due to the fact that the roof of the Integra is too short. The actuator and motor for the moonroof require more room beyond that of the glass.
Co-incidentally, the same manufacturer was chosen by Saturn for the moonroof on the Saturn SL Coupe.

My boyfriend and I just got back from a cross-country road trip and his car has the moonroof that slides up over the car like the Integras. Although it does make a dramatic effect, it proved to be a major pain in the butt in terms of how much noise it made on the open road. I dunno, I suppose it's a matter of preference if you like the look and are willing to deal with that little drawback.
